Connecting Your Wyze Watch

Before you can adjust anything, you need to ensure your Wyze Watch is correctly paired with your smartphone. This is the foundational step for all settings management on the device. The pairing process links your watch to the Wyze app, giving you control over its functions and settings, including the time.

Initial Setup

  • Download the Wyze app: Begin by downloading the Wyze app from either the Google Play Store or the Apple App Store, depending on your phone’s operating system. Ensure you are downloading the official application to avoid issues or security concerns.
  • Create an Account: If you don’t already have a Wyze account, you’ll need to create one. This account will link to all your Wyze devices, simplifying management and syncing information.
  • Pair Your Watch: With the app open, follow the on-screen instructions to pair your Wyze Watch with your smartphone. This usually involves activating Bluetooth on your phone and following prompts within the app to connect to the watch.

Setting the Time on Your Wyze Watch

Once your Wyze Watch is successfully paired with your smartphone via the Wyze app, setting the time is generally automatic. However, there are instances where manual intervention might be required. This section details how to ensure your watch displays the correct time.

Automatic Time Synchronization

The Wyze Watch usually uses your phone’s time settings as a reference. It automatically syncs with your phone’s time zone and current time to maintain accuracy. This typically happens whenever the watch connects to your phone.

Manual Time Adjustment (If Necessary)

  • Check App Settings: In rare cases, the automatic syncing might malfunction. The Wyze app often has settings related to time synchronization and date. Review these options to ensure automatic syncing is enabled.
  • Restart Your Watch: A simple restart can often resolve minor software glitches that might be causing time discrepancies. The process of restarting the watch is usually described in the Wyze app’s user manual.
  • Factory Reset (Last Resort): If the time remains inaccurate after attempting all other methods, performing a factory reset on the watch may resolve more persistent issues. However, remember this will erase all data on the watch.

Troubleshooting Common Time Issues

Despite the automatic time synchronization, occasional issues can occur. This section addresses common problems users face when setting the time on their Wyze Watch and provides practical solutions.

Time Discrepancies

  • Check Phone’s Time Settings: Begin by ensuring your phone’s time and date settings are accurate. The watch syncs with your phone, so an incorrect setting on the phone will directly affect the watch.
  • Battery Life: Low battery power on your watch or smartphone can interfere with time synchronization. Charge both devices to full capacity and try again.
  • App Updates: Update both the Wyze app and the watch firmware to ensure you have the most recent bug fixes and improvements. Outdated versions may contain bugs affecting the time sync.

Time Zone Errors

  • Location Services: Ensure location services are enabled on your phone and your Wyze app has the necessary permissions to access your location data. This is essential for accurate time zone detection.
  • Airplane Mode: If airplane mode is activated on your phone, the watch might not be able to sync with network time servers resulting in an inaccurate time display. Disable airplane mode and try syncing again.
  • Manual Time Zone Adjustment (Within the App): As a last resort, you can attempt manually setting your time zone within the Wyze app’s settings. Select your current time zone from the list of available options. This might be helpful if the automatic detection is consistently wrong.

FAQ

How often does my Wyze Watch automatically update its time?

The Wyze Watch generally updates its time automatically whenever it connects to your smartphone, often several times a day. The frequency depends on factors like phone connectivity and app usage.

What if my Wyze Watch shows the wrong time zone?

If the time zone is incorrect, ensure your phone’s location services are enabled and accurate. You may also need to check the time zone settings within the Wyze app or perform a restart of both the phone and the watch.

Can I set the time manually on the watch face itself?

Most Wyze Watch models do not allow direct time setting on the watch face. The primary method is via the Wyze app or automatic synchronization.

My Wyze Watch is completely unresponsive; how do I set the time?

Try restarting the watch. If it remains unresponsive, you may need to perform a factory reset (this will erase all data), or contact Wyze support.

Why is my Wyze Watch’s time always a few seconds behind?

Minor discrepancies of a few seconds are normal due to the time synchronization process. Larger discrepancies might indicate a connection issue, low battery, or a software glitch.

Will my Wyze Watch automatically adjust for Daylight Saving Time?

If your phone’s time zone settings are correctly configured, your Wyze Watch should automatically adjust for Daylight Saving Time transitions.
